SUMMARY OF POSITION
This role is pivotal in designing, organizing, and executing comprehensive, city-wide programs and activities that bring our community to life. Operating with a high degree of autonomy under the guidance of the Parks and Public Facilities Director, this position leads a dedicated team of professionals to deliver exceptional recreational experiences, events, and opportunities for City of Richland residents of all ages.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E:
Associates/technical degree in Recreation, or related field
Three (3) years of experience in recreation programming
Two (2) years in a supervisory role
Any equivalent combination of education and experience that provides the required knowledge, skills, and abilities will be considered.
S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:
Valid driver’s license
Obtain First Aid, CPR, Defibrillator Certifications within three (3) months of hire
DESIRABLE QUALIFICATIONS
Certified Parks & Recreation Professional (CPRP)
Certified Pool Operator/Aquatic Facilities Operator (CPO/AFO)
Experience with management of aquatics facilities
Bachelor’s degree in Recreation Management or equivalent related degree program
